I am about to write a script that generates graphviz/dot graphs with the following two characteristics:
- All except one node have excactly one parent node (so, it's a tree).
- If two or more node share the sampe parent node, they themselves are in a specific order.
With these characteristics, I'd like my resulting (that is dot-generated graph) to look like so:
- No edges should cross
- Nodes with the same parent should have the same distance from the graphs top border.
- Nodes with the same parent should be drawn from left to right according to their ordering
However, I can't make dot behave the way I'd like. Here's a dot file to demonstrate my problem:

results in

Note, the ordering between siblings is indicated by the grey edges (arrows).
So, for example, I am happy with the seven -> three -> five -> eighteen siblings, since they are drawn from left to right in their correct order (as indicated by the arrows).
But I am unhappy with the siblings eight -> thirteen -> fivteen because their edges cross other edges and because their ordering is not from left to right, as I'd like.
Also, nine -> ten, twenty -> twenty-one and nineteen -> twenty-two are in the wrong direction.
I am aware that I could probably get to a picture as I want if I used additional (invisible) edges and the weight attribute and possibly even more features. But as the graphs (and there are many of those) are generated by a script, I can't do that manually.
So, is there a way to achieve what I want?
